Understanding the Importance of Facebook Pixel in Digital Marketing
The Facebook Pixel is an essential asset for businesses navigating the expansive landscape of digital marketing.By leveraging this powerful tool,marketers can collect critical data on user interactions with their website. This not only helps in understanding customer behavior but also enables the creation of highly targeted ad campaigns. With the pixel installed, you can track conversions, optimize ads, and retarget potential customers with precision. This means businesses can effectively tailor their marketing strategies, ensuring that every dollar spent on ads yields the highest return on investment.
Moreover, the data collected through Facebook Pixel plays a crucial role in measuring the success of marketing efforts. Key metrics such as page views, time on site, and specific actions taken by users provide invaluable insights into what works and what doesn’t. By analyzing this information, businesses can adjust their strategies to improve engagement and conversion rates. Here are some significant benefits of employing the Facebook Pixel:
- Enhanced Targeting: Reach users who have previously engaged with your business.
- Conversion Tracking: Assess the direct impact of ads on purchases.
- Custom Audiences: Create tailored audiences based on website interactions.
- Lookalike Audiences: Discover new customers with similar traits to your existing ones.
Common Tracking Issues Faced by facebook Advertisers
Facebook advertisers often encounter a range of tracking issues that can undermine their campaign effectiveness. One common problem is the inaccurate event tracking, where the Pixel fails to capture user interactions correctly. This can lead to misleading data analytics, causing advertisers to make decisions based on flawed insights. Another prevalent issue is the improper Pixel installation,where the code may be missing or placed incorrectly on the website,disrupting its functionality and preventing it from firing as intended.
Additionally, advertisers frequently face attribution discrepancies, where conversions are not accurately attributed to the relevant campaigns or ads. This can stem from users interacting with multiple touchpoints before converting, leading to confusion regarding which ad was truly responsible for the sale. to combat these challenges, it’s crucial to regularly audit your Pixel setup, ensuring it aligns with the goals of your campaigns and that all events are firing as thay should. Moreover, employing tools and browser extensions can help in diagnosing and troubleshooting these issues effectively.
Diagnosing Facebook Pixel Problems: Step-by-Step Techniques
When troubleshooting Facebook Pixel issues, the first step is to determine whether the Pixel is firing correctly on your website. Use the Facebook pixel Helper tool, a Chrome extension that allows you to check if your Pixel is installed correctly and tracking the right events. open your website and click on the extension; if everything is functioning correctly, you’ll see a green notification. If not, you may encounter errors or warnings that can guide you in pinpointing specific problems. Ensure that your Pixel ID matches the one in your Facebook Business Manager, as this is crucial for accurate data collection.
Another common issue arises from improper event tracking. To ensure your events are set up correctly, navigate to the Events Manager in your Facebook Business Manager. Here, you can check the events being received in real-time. Compare the list of events you’ve set up against the actions users are taking on your site. If you notice discrepancies, return to your website code to verify event parameters.Use the following checklist to cross-reference crucial aspects:

implementing Best Practices for Facebook Pixel Installation
To ensure an effective Facebook Pixel installation, it’s paramount to follow a set of best practices that streamline the tracking process and improve the accuracy of your data. Start by placing the pixel code in the section of your website’s HTML to guarantee it loads on every page. Additionally, utilizing a single pixel across multiple websites can simplify your tracking efforts and prevent data fragmentation. Be vigilant about regularly checking for pixel firing errors; tools like the Facebook Pixel Helper Chrome extension can quickly alert you to any issues.
It’s also essential to define and implement standard events that align with your business goals. By doing so, you can better target key actions such as purchases, add-to-carts, or registrations. Consider maintaining a structured approach to your event setup by following these guidelines:
Action | Event Name | Recommended Data |
---|---|---|
Initial Page Load | PageView | URL, Page Title |
User Signup | CompleteRegistration | Registration Method |
adding an Item to Cart | AddToCart | Item ID, Value |
Making a Purchase | Purchase | Transaction ID, Value, Currency |
Utilizing Facebook’s Event Manager for Troubleshooting
when facing issues with Facebook tracking, leveraging Facebook’s Event Manager is essential for effective troubleshooting.This powerful tool allows you to analyze your pixel data in real-time and pinpoint any discrepancies that may be causing tracking problems. By navigating to the Events tab, you can monitor the performance of your pixel and see which events are successfully fired. Ensure you check for the following common indicators:
- Event Status: Verify if the events are labeled as Active.
- Error messages: Pay attention to any warnings or error notifications.
- Event Configuration: Double-check the setup for any custom events to ensure accuracy.
Additionally, the Debugging feature in Event Manager provides deeper insights into your pixel implementation. Here,you can review the data being sent from your website and identify any issues with your parameters.It’s essential to assess the following attributes during your examination:

Q1: What is a Facebook Pixel, and why is it important for digital marketers?
A1: The Facebook Pixel is a snippet of code that marketers place on their websites to track user interactions and optimize advertising efforts. By monitoring actions such as page views, purchases, and sign-ups, the Pixel enables businesses to measure the effectiveness of their ads, retarget website visitors, and create lookalike audiences. Q2: What are common issues that can arise with facebook Pixel tracking?
A2: Oh,the woes of tracking! Common issues include improper installation,missing events,duplicate events,and data discrepancies.For instance, if the Pixel is not correctly coded on a webpage, or if events are fired multiple times due to misconfigurations, it can lead to inaccurate data reporting. Q3: How can I verify if my Facebook Pixel is working correctly?
A3: Thankfully, Facebook provides tools to assist with Pixel diagnostics. The Facebook Pixel Helper is a handy Chrome extension that can verify if your Pixel is active on your website. It will display whether your Pixel is firing correctly and highlight any issues. additionally, the Events Manager within Facebook ads lets you monitor events triggered and verify that your data is being processed as expected.
Q4: What steps can I take if my Pixel is not firing as expected?
A4: First, ensure that your Pixel is correctly installed. Double-check the specific code snippet on your website—placing it in the right spot in the header is crucial. Next, check your browser settings to ensure they aren’t blocking tracking scripts.If everything looks fine but the Pixel is still not firing, consider setting up custom events or utilizing the Facebook Events Setup Tool to streamline configuration.

Q6: What should I do if my Pixel is recording duplicate events?
A6: Duplicate events can muddy your data and mislead your strategies. To resolve this, ensure the event code isn’t firing multiple times on a single action, perhaps due to incorrect placement or JavaScript issues. Reviewing your website’s source code for any multiple instances of the Pixel and checking any additional event tracking setups is a smart move.
